Kevin De Bruyne was targeted by lasers during Belgium's Euro 2024 clash with Ukraine - but he very nearly had the last laugh.

Manchester City star De Bruyne was captaining his side in the crucial Group E encounter when he lined up to take a free-kick around 45 yards out and to the right of the goal.

As the likes of Romelu Lukaku, Amadou Onana and Wout Faes waited for De Bruyne to deliver a cross into the box, he stopped and began gesturing to referee Anthony Taylor.

It was quickly apparent that a green laser was being shone in De Bruyne's eyes as he took the kick, and he after his complaint to Taylor the Premier League referee reported the incident to the fourth official.

Angered, De Bruyne then returned to the ball and, as players on both sides prepared for him to cross, he brilliantly went for goal and almost caught out Ukraine goalkeeper Anatolii Trubin, who dived to his left and was delighted to see the shot hit the side-netting.

Belgium and Ukraine went into the match tied on three points in Group E, with Slovakia and Romania also on three points after all four teams won one game and lost one game in the group.
